Cambridge House British International School is a highly distinguished British international school and was the first in Spain to gain both BSO (British School Overseas) and NABSS (National Association for British Schools in Spain) accreditation.

Founded more than 30 years ago in Valencia (East Spain), this progressive school with strong family values and delivering the English National Curriculum now has 1,700 students and has evolved to meet the needs of modern learners. Students aged three to 18 attend the school and follow the National English Early Years Framework and the English National Curriculum. Year 12 and 13 students take A-levels and gain accreditation for the Spanish Baccalaureate and can also choose to follow a Higher National Diploma (HND) route, providing vocational pathways.

We are seeking an experienced and dynamic LSA to join our school.

Roles And Responsibilities

  • Support Students: Assist students in accessing the curriculum and completing tasks.
  • Classroom Assistance: Help the teacher with lesson delivery, classroom activities, and maintaining a positive learning environment.
  • Monitor Progress: Observe students’ progress and report feedback to teachers on their development.
  • Emotional and Social Support: Provide guidance to students with emotional, social, or behavioural challenges.
  • Collaboration: Work with teachers and staff to ensure effective support for students.
  • Encourage Independence: Help students develop independent learning and organisational skills.
  • Safeguarding: Follow school safeguarding policies to ensure student welfare.
